Currensee

Founded in 2008 and headquartered in Boston, Currensee was one of the first online social networks for foreign exchange (forex) traders. The company developed a platform where retail traders could link their existing brokerage accounts and automatically mirror the investment strategies of top-performing traders, known as "Trade Leaders." This model of copy trading provided a way for less experienced investors to participate in the forex market by leveraging the expertise of others. In September 2013, Currensee was acquired by the global forex broker OANDA. However, OANDA ultimately decided to shut down the Currensee platform on October 31, 2014, to focus on integrating the underlying technology and talent into its own proprietary offerings.
